Introduction to Duo Ovens
A duo oven, also known as a dual oven or double oven, is a type of oven that combines two separate cooking compartments into one unit. This design allows for simultaneous cooking of different dishes at varying temperatures, making it an ideal choice for home cooks and professional chefs alike. The concept of duo ovens has been around for several decades, but recent advancements in technology have made them more accessible, affordable, and feature-rich.

Key Features of Modern Duo Ovens
Modern duo ovens boast an array of features that enhance the cooking experience. Some of the key features include:
- Independent Temperature Control: Each oven compartment can be set to a different temperature, allowing for simultaneous cooking of various dishes.
- Advanced Cooking Modes: Many duo ovens come with specialized cooking modes, such as convection, steam, and slow cooking, which enable users to achieve perfect results for a wide range of recipes.
- Large Capacity: Duo ovens often have a larger overall capacity than single ovens, making them perfect for big families, entertaining, or cooking for special occasions.
- Energy Efficiency: Modern duo ovens are designed to be energy-efficient, using less power than two separate single ovens while providing the same functionality.
- Smart Technology Integration: Some high-end duo ovens come with smart technology features, such as Wi-Fi connectivity, mobile app control, and voice assistant integration, making it easy to monitor and control your cooking remotely.

Can I use a duo oven for both cooking and baking, or are there specific models designed for each task?
Duo ovens can be used for both cooking and baking, and many models are designed to accommodate a wide range of culinary tasks. However, some duo ovens may be more suited to cooking or baking, depending on their features and design. For example, a duo oven with a larger oven cavity and more powerful heating elements may be better suited to cooking roasts or large meals, while a model with a smaller oven cavity and more precise temperature control may be more suitable for baking delicate pastries or cakes. Users should consider their specific cooking and baking needs and choose a duo oven that is designed to meet those needs.
When using a duo oven for both cooking and baking, users should be aware of the different cooking modes and settings required for each task. For example, baking often requires a more precise temperature control and a dry heat environment, while cooking may require a higher temperature and more moisture. Duo ovens often come with pre-set cooking modes and settings for common tasks, such as roasting, baking, or broiling, which can help users achieve optimal results. Additionally, users can experiment with different cooking techniques and recipes to find the best ways to use their duo oven for both cooking and baking.

Are duo ovens energy-efficient, and how can I minimize my energy consumption when using one?
Duo ovens can be energy-efficient, especially when compared to using multiple separate ovens or cooking appliances. By allowing users to cook multiple dishes at once, duo ovens can help reduce the overall energy consumption required for meal preparation. Additionally, many modern duo ovens come with advanced features such as energy-saving modes, automatic shut-off, and smart cooking algorithms, which can help optimize energy consumption and reduce waste. However, energy efficiency can vary depending on the specific model and usage patterns, and users should consider the energy consumption of their duo oven when choosing a model and planning their cooking tasks.
To minimize energy consumption when using a duo oven, users should follow several best practices, such as using the correct cooking mode and temperature for each dish, avoiding overcooking or undercooking, and using the oven’s energy-saving features. Users should also consider cooking in batches, using the oven’s residual heat to cook additional dishes, and keeping the oven doors closed to minimize heat loss. Additionally, users can look for duo ovens with energy-efficient certifications, such as Energy Star, and follow the manufacturer’s guidelines for optimal energy consumption.
